Ron Herbst is a supervisor in a clinical laboratory. He has noticed that one of his employees regularly comes to work in a surly mood. The employee is getting his work done on time, but his attitude seems to be affecting the other employees.

a. How can Ron initiate conflict resolution with this employee? How should he describe the problem?

b. If the employee responds to Ron’s statement of the problem by saying, “I’m fine. Don’t worry about me,” what should the supervisor do and say?
